Prevent workplace fires and respond to emergencies by identifying hazards, using extinguishers, and following evacuation protocols.
This course equips workers and safety professionals with essential knowledge to prevent fires, identify potential fire hazards, and respond effectively to emergencies. Participants will learn to implement fire prevention plans, handle fire extinguishers correctly, and follow evacuation protocols to ensure workplace safety. The curriculum covers industry-specific risks in construction, general industry, and live entertainment, providing practical strategies to mitigate these dangers. By the end of the course, learners will be prepared to comply with fire safety regulations and take proactive measures to protect lives and property.
